"The troublesome thing here is that I think most bitcoin investors buy bitcoin with the implicit expectation that this kind of thing will _just work_ or they're not even aware of the outstanding problem. Is bitcoin really all that special for the world if it can only be interfaced with through a couple of third parties I don't think most people would think so but they're never really given a disclaimer on the current state of scaling so the question doesn't occur to them. I don't think we've made good on the promise yet"

"I regret to inform you that bitcoin has not yet solved the scaling problem in an ideologically coherent way (some will say scaling is solved essentially by custodians -- trusted third parties -- though they won't use that term. But that in the limit defeats the point of bitcoin) would be a good start Another good start would be a serious evaluation of the _actual_ trade-offs associated with larger block size (started very casually here Almost everyone serious knows this innately even if they aren't saying it. It's just easier to talk about less consequential things"
